t <br />G&}Q06: 1995 Annual Reclamation Rcoorr, Mr. Gcona Petlerson2 <br />Great basin wildrye at 20 #/acre, with the strips spaced at 180 foot intervals was drill <br />seeded into the 720 pit area after the permanent seed mix had been applied. <br />Additional seed mix no. 14453 was included as well. 'This mix consists of forbs and shrubs <br />only. The Division speculates that this mix was strip seeded alongside strips seeded with <br />mixes 14021 and 14022. This absence of grasses in the mix may aid in shrub establishment. <br />This practice is not spelled out in the permit nor is it explained in the reclamation report. <br />Please elaborate on how seed mix 14453 was utilized. Rates of application and frequency <br />of distribution would suffice. <br />Annual winter rye was planted to serve as a cover crop at pit 1, and along the reclaimed <br />roadways. The 1995 annual reclamation report indicates that the permanent seedmix would <br />be planted in the Spring of 1996 at Pit 1 and along the reclaimed roads. It has been the <br />Division's observation that permanent seed mix seeding did not occur in the Spring of 1996 <br />and should occur in the Fall of 1996. <br />The Division finds Kerr Coal Company's 1995 Annual Reclamation Report and ]995 <br />Reclamation Map to provide the necessary information to document reclamation activities <br />conducted at the Marr Mine during 1995.
